首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ql数据库多少列

MySQL数据库的列数没有固定限制,理论上可以有无限多个列。MySQL是一种关系型数据库管理系统,它使用表来组织和存储数据,每个表由一个或多个列组成。列是表中的一个字段,用于存储特定类型的数据。每个列都有一个名称和数据类型,可以根据需要定义。

MySQL的列数取决于以下几个因素:

  1. 表的设计需求:根据数据的组织和存储需求,可以自由定义表的列数。
  2. 数据库管理系统的限制:MySQL对于每个表的列数有一定的限制,具体限制取决于MySQL版本和配置参数。在常见的MySQL版本中,列数的限制通常在4096列左右,对于普通应用场景而言,这已经足够满足大多数需求。

在实际应用中,根据数据的结构化程度和表的设计范式,尽量遵循数据库的设计规范,将相关数据存储在同一表中,避免过多的列数导致表的冗余和不规范。如果需要处理更大规模的数据,可以采用分库分表的方式进行水平扩展,将数据分散存储在多个数据库或表中,提高系统的可伸缩性和性能。

腾讯云提供了多个与MySQL相关的产品和服务,可以帮助用户快速搭建、管理和运维MySQL数据库。其中包括:

  1. 云数据库MySQL:腾讯云提供的一种高性能、可扩展的云数据库服务,支持自动备份、故障切换、读写分离等功能,满足各种规模和性能要求的应用场景。详情请参考:云数据库 MySQL
  2. 云数据库TDSQL:腾讯云提供的企业级高可用MySQL数据库服务,具备高可靠性、高性能、高安全性和高可扩展性。支持主从复制、容灾备份、性能优化等功能,适用于企业级应用的数据库需求。详情请参考:云数据库 TDSQL

以上是关于MySQL数据库列数的答案,希望能对您有所帮助。如果您有更多问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券